Secondary Electron Yield Curve for Liquid Water
Abstract We have measured the secondary electron yield curve for liquid water using an Environmental SEM. The secondary electron emission coefficient, measured as a function of incident electron energy, is important for interpreting contrast in hydrated biological and inorganic specimens.

Analytical model for secondary electron yield of composite layered structures
An analytical model is developed to calculate the secondary electron yield (SEY) of composite layered structures, based on two independent physical parameters of secondary electron emission.
